Hi guys,



I have just turned off the O2 sensor from the power fc and it seems like my surging idle problem is somewhat solved.. can i run it like this..



Is it a permanent solution?

rfreeman27 06-09-2004 07:14 PM

you can run wothout the O2...



your car will just run a little dirtier i think

qwester007 06-10-2004 12:44 AM

Very bad idea. The reason you have a pfc is to help monitor and adjust your engines settings. Why not tune it properly? You'll get better gas mileage, more power and you'll have less chance of detonating an engine.

jspecracer7 06-10-2004 09:10 AM

I have been running without a stock O2 sensor for over 2 years now with no ill effects. Gas Mileage wasn't affected too much either. I did get slightly less gas mileage, but that could be easily fixed with a decent tuning on the lower end. Also note...I have a wideband 02 to do the tuning.

Sinful7 06-10-2004 10:26 AM

I intend on disconnecting the O2 semi-permanently after I get it tuned out with a wideband.

SevenX 06-12-2004 11:12 PM

I leave mine off as well. Its alot better then the surging and buying a new o2 sensor to fix that surging.
